## Building Access: Mail Room Relocation

The mail room at Thistledown House has moved from the ground floor to room 1.14 on the first floor, next to the print hub. Collect parcels between 09:00 and 17:00; uncollected items return to the sorting shelf after three days. New starters should note the old ground-floor room is now storage. The new mail room door requires the entry code below.

badge for hahip-bagag: bdg-FIJ-9

- [ ] Step 7: Archive cold storage buckets (Glacierline tier). Confirm both ceremony witnesses are present, verify bucket manifests match the Oxbow ledger, then seal the archive key shares. Plugin authors may observe but not handle shares. Once sealed, the archive index itself is encrypted and can only be reopened with the passphrase below.

vault phrase of badup-hahig = tamael-aldael-kelmir-istael-fenok-istwyn-tamius-jorath-oliion

// REINDEX_BATCH_CAP limits docs per shard pass in the Tallowfield
// nightly search reindex. Raising it starves the ingest queue;
// lowering it overruns the maintenance window. 5000 is the tested
// sweet spot. Change only with a soak run. Verified against the
// build noted below.

session token of bawif-hahog = htk6_ac5981